While many students think of summer as a time to drop the books and head out into the sunshine, savvy students know that summer is actually a valuable time that they can use to get ahead in their academics. Reading and discussing a classic novel or doing challenging math problems can keep students sharp through the summer months, a time that many don't equate with doing much school work. This also ensures that students won't suffer from what is called summer learning loss, in which students actually lose some of the skills that they learning throughout the previous year due to inactivity. As much as two month's worth of math skills can be lost during the summer months.
